POOR MANS CAKE

3 c. flour
2 c. sugar
2 tsp. soda
1/3 c. cocoa
1 tsp. salt (opt.)
1 tsp. vanilla
1/4 c. vinegar
1 c. oil
2 c. cold water

Sift flour, sugar, soda, cocoa and salt in a 9"x13" ungreased pan. Mix together with a fork. Make 3 "holes" in dry ingredients. Pour vanilla in one hole, vinegar in one and oil in all three. Pour cold water over entire mixture. Blend thoroughly with a fork. Do not beat. Bake at 350 degrees for 35 to 40 minuets or until springs back to touch. Good with either hot caramel frosting or chocolate frosting.
